This week on the Greatvine we chat with CQUniversity's Deputy Director of Development and Alumni Relations Francois Gallais. His first ambition was to be a professional soccer player, but once he discovered his skill set didn't match his passion, a young Francois quickly turned his attention to another love ... cheese. In this week's podcast, we hear how Francois' early years growing up in France involved a robust school life with a mix of soccer and tennis, which eventually led him to business school and later a Masters in Marketing at a university in the UK, followed by his first job selling cheese – very French! We hear about his roles in fundraising and how being 'too comfortable in France' led to his family moving to Central Queensland where he landed a role at CQUni. We learn about CQUni's diverse alumni and Francois' role to provide opportunities for individuals and organisations to engage with and support CQUni's endeavours. Finally, we learn that life is pretty busy for this father of three, who spends his spare time sailing and being a taxi for his teenage children.
